П# | ПК | |
И# | Кол | |
П1 | И1 И2 И3 | |
П2 | И1 И2 | |
П3 | И4 |
П# | И# | Кол |
П1 П1 П1 П2 П2 П3 | И1 И2 И3 И1 И2 И4 |
Можно заметить, в таблице на пересечении, например, строки П1 и столбца И# содержится несколько значений номеров изделий. Другими словами, в отношении ПОСТАВКИ1 значения ключа П# идентифицирует сразу несколько значений не ключевых атрибутов И# и Кол, что недопустимо. Это отношение находится не в 1НФ.
Преобразуем отношение так, чтобы устранить этот недостаток. В преобразованном отношении ПОСТАВКИ первичный ключ - составной П# И# и каждое значение первичного ключа идентифицирует единственное значение не ключевого атрибута Кол. Это отношение находится в 1НФ.